Purchasing Notes
By Susan Avery -- Purchasing, 11/5/1998
Office Depot and Boise Cascade Office Products were among the suppliers on hand at the Internet Commerce Expo in Los Angeles recently to demonstrate use of the Open Buying on the Internet (OBI) standard. Other companies involved include American Express, connect Inc., IBM, Intellisys, Microsoft, and Netscape. While the standard has garnered support throughout the industry, the OBI Action Showcase was the first large-scale public demo of electronic commerce systems that use its blueprint and architecture.
